fwilde 4.1 441 The magification values may vary about +/-5%. Thus the FOV and eff. pix. sizes vary accordingly.
442
fwilde 14.1 443 **Due to the resolving power of the microscope the spatial resolution of the system is limited to ~~1µm, regardless of the effective pixel size!**
